Zhengchao An 8eba7bb9be test(filemeta): add version-graph marshal/load roundtrip properties (#4849)
xl.meta roundtrip coverage was one fixed example test plus byte-level no-panic
fuzz properties; nothing generated STRUCTURED version graphs, so a lossy
encoding bug in version headers, ordering, delete markers, or the dual
internal-metadata-key handling would only surface if the fixed example happened
to hit it.

Add crates/filemeta/tests/version_graph_roundtrip_proptest.rs with two
generated-input properties over multi-version graphs (1-7 versions, ~30% delete
markers, deliberately colliding mod_times to exercise tie-break ordering, user
metadata, and the AGENTS.md dual x-rustfs-internal-*/x-minio-internal-* keys
written via the real insert_bytes helper):

- version_graph_marshal_load_roundtrip: marshal -> load preserves version
  count, meta_ver, the exact (id, type) sequence, full headers, fully decoded
  per-version content, delete-marker payload shape, and both internal metadata
  key forms with identical values.
- version_graph_marshal_is_idempotent: marshal(load(marshal(x))) is
  byte-identical to marshal(x), catching encoders that mutate or reorder state
  on the way out.

Complements the existing byte-level no-panic properties: those prove hostile
bytes cannot crash the decoder; these prove honest graphs are encoded
losslessly.
